A solar PPA for garden centres typically prices at 13–16 p/kWh in year one on a 100–300kWp system, versus 28–32 p/kWh grid import. The provider funds, owns and maintains the system over 15–25 years and you buy only the power generated — no capital outlay.
| Typical system size | 100–300kWp |
| Year-1 tariff | 13–16 p/kWh |
| Best-fit structure | On-site PPA (sleeved for multi-site groups) |
Few businesses match a rooftop's output as neatly as a garden centre. You trade in daylight and close at dusk, so demand and generation rise and fall together with almost no wasted export. On top of retail lighting and tills, heated glasshouses and polytunnels, propagation lighting, aquatics pumps and the on-site café all draw through the day — and spring, your busiest season, is also when solar output climbs steeply, so peak trade coincides with peak generation.
Garden-centre arrays usually sit between 100 and 300kWp, with power purchase tariffs in the 13–16 p/kWh band — reflecting the smaller, retail scale, yet still undercutting grid rates and fixed for the contract term. Large canopy and outbuilding roofs often carry the system, and where glasshouse glazing rules out roof mounting, a car-park or nursery-yard ground array can make up the shortfall. Horticulture customers tend to care about sustainability, so visible panels and lower-carbon heating reinforce exactly the values that bring people through your gates.
